Role Overview
Support data processing and system revamp initiatives through strong SAS development and data quality capabilities. This role focuses on delivering accurate, reliable, and high-quality data outputs using SAS, while leveraging Python for supporting ETL and data processing tasks. You will work with large datasets, contribute to data validation and reconciliation efforts, and coll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ure successful delivery of data-driven projects.
Key Responsibilities
Develop, maintain, and enhance SAS programs for data processing and analysis
Perform data extraction, transformation, validation, and reconciliation to ensure data quality
Analyse and troubleshoot data issues, ensuring accuracy and integrity
Support A/B comparison analysis and data validation activities
Contribute to Python-based data processing and ETL workflows where required
Build and maintain ETL pipelines for data cleaning and transformation
Work with Oracle databases to manage and process data
Participate in system integration testing (SIT), user acceptance testing (UAT), and deployment
Collaborate with cross-functional teams to support system enhancements and data initiatives
Requirements & Preferred Profile
SAS Certified Specialist (Base Programming Using SAS 9.4)
Strong hands-on experience in SAS programming (core requirement)
Solid understanding of data quality, validation, and reconciliation
Working knowledge of Python (e.g., OOP concepts, Pandas, ETL/data processing)
Intermediate SQL proficiency (Oracle) and basic exposure to GitHub
Strong analytical, problem-solving, and troubleshooting skills
Experience in large-scale data environments or system revamp projects is advantageous
Exposure to government or enterprise data systems is a plus
Collaborative, detail-oriented, and able to work in fast-paced project environments
This role requires eligibility for government security clearance (CAT 1).
Due to project requirements, this role is open to Singapore Citizens only

Recruitment fraud is a scheme in which fictitious job opportunities are offered to job seekers typically through online services, such as false websites, or through unsolicited emails claiming to be from the company. These emails may request recipients to provide personal information or to make payments as part of their illegitimate recruiting process. DXC does not make offers of employment via social media networks and DXC never asks for any money or payments from applicants at any point in the recruitment process, nor ask a job seeker to purchase IT or other equipment on our behalf.
